Have you considered how critical metal edging is to the overall health of your roof?What is Metal Roof Edging?Metal roof edging, commonly referred to as eaves or drip edge, consists of a metal strip affixed along the perimeter of your roof. Its fundamental purpose is to channel water away from the roof's underlying structure, thereby preventing moisture-related damage. Firstly, it markedly decreases the likelihood of water accumulation and subsequent leaks. Secondly, it reinforces the structural stability of roof panels, especially during severe weather conditions like strong winds. Finally, it provides a refined appearance that boosts your home's overall aesthetic—who doesn’t want a beautiful home?Choosing the Right Metal Roof EdgingWhen choosing the appropriate metal roof edging, consider both material and style. Aluminum and steel are popular choices, each with distinct durability and aesthetic qualities. Additionally, pay close attention to the gauge of the metal; thicker gauges generally afford superior protection against harsh weather.
